Just read this stood up all in one go. What a lovely little graphic novel about finding connection through anxiety and depression. I thought the portrayal of intrusive thoughts was particularly good, as well as the way it showed how quickly you can spiral into self-doubt and punishment when you find yourself in crisis. It also somehow achieves the most naturalistic speech I've seen in writing in a while.
